Построение блок-схемы алгоритма с использованием цикла и ветвления Вычислите значение...

0 голосов
51 просмотров

Построение блок-схемы алгоритма с использованием цикла и
ветвления

Вычислите значение заданной
функции, если Х изменяется от Хнач до Хкон с ΔХ (в качестве
исходных данных может использоваться другая переменная. Если при
функции стоят знаки суммы (Σ̈) или произведения (Π) то ΔХ=1)


очень нужно,помогите пожалуйста,заранее спасибо!


image

Информатика (15 баллов) | 51 просмотров
Дан 1 ответ
0 голосов
Правильный ответ

Function y1(var x: double): double;
begin
  if x <= 2 then begin<br>    result := 3*x*cos(x);
  end
  else if x <= 8 then begin<br>    result := 3*x*x*x - x*x;
  end;
end;

function y2(var x: double): double;
begin
  result := x + power(e, -x);
end;

function z(var x: double): double;
begin
  result := power(y1(x), 2)+ y2(x);
end;

begin
  var x : integer;
  var x0: double;
 
  for x := 0 to 8 do begin
    x0 := x;
    writeln(z(x0));
  end;
end.

(9.2k баллов)